Section 28-4-251 - Search warrant for seizure of prohibited liquors and beverages, etc., generally - Issuance - Authorization and procedure generally.

Universal Citation: AL Code § 28-4-251 (2018)
Section 28-4-251Search warrant for seizure of prohibited liquors and beverages, etc., generally - Issuance - Authorization and procedure generally.

Search warrants for the seizure of liquors and beverages that are prohibited to be sold or otherwise disposed of in this state, together with the vessel or other receptacle in which they are contained, may be issued as prescribed in this article, and proceedings may be had to secure the destruction of such liquors, beverages, vessels and receptacles upon the grounds and in the manner provided in this article.

(Acts 1909, No. 191, p. 63; Acts 1915, No. 2, p. 8; Code 1923, §4741; Code 1940, T. 29, §210; Acts 1951, No. 905, p. 1544.)
